Cold Chain Cloud — это облачный SaaS-сервис, который решает две основные задачи:
- Первая — сбор, мониторинг и хранение в одном месте данных от большого количества средств измерительной техники (логгеры, датчики, регистраторы и т.д.). Средства измерительной техники могут взаимодействовать с Cold Chain Cloud по различным протоколам обмена данными и находиться в разных географических точках;
- Вторая — предоставление авторизованного доступа пользователям к данным измерений через веб-интерфейс и отображение этих данных в удобном для пользователя виде.
Cold Chain Cloud — это платформонезависимый сервис. Пользователь взаимодействует с Cold Chain Cloud через веб-браузер. При этом пользователю не нужно устанавливать на компьютер какое-либо дополнительное программное обеспечение.
Преимущество Cold Chain Cloud заключается в том, что сервис построен на клиент-серверной архитектуре. Такая архитектура позволяет перенести часть нагрузки по обработке данных с сервера на гаджет или компьютер клиента, что увеличивает производительность и надежность сервиса.
Серверная часть обеспечивает, с одной стороны, взаимодействие через серверное API со средствами измерительной техники (логгеры, датчики, регистраторы и т.д.). С другой стороны, серверная часть через клиентское API взаимодействует с клиентской частью, предоставляя ей данные в соответствии с запросом пользователя. Таким образом, основные функции серверной части — это сбор, первичная обработка, хранение, резервирование данных и предоставление данных клиентской части.
Серверная часть является программным обеспечением, написанным на языках программирования JavaScript (Node.Js) и C++. Серверная часть работает под управлением OS Linux и размещается на серверах в дата-центре. Клиентская часть представляет собой JavaScript (AngularJS) приложение, которое автоматически загружается в веб-браузер пользователя и работает до момента закрытия вкладки с сервисом. Клиентский сервис предоставляет интерфейсы для взаимодействия пользователя с данными в реальном времени, такие как: отображение в графическом виде архивных данных всех приборов, просмотр графиков, архивов, логических событий, аварий, различных виджетов, настройка системы и другое.
Cold Chain Cloud предоставляет пользователю гибкую систему разграничения прав пользователей, которая предварительно настраивается администратором системы. Пользователей можно разделять на разные группы с различными полномочиями и ролями: администраторы, операторы, пользователи и т.д. В зависимости от предоставленных прав пользователь может изменять или просматривать только доступные ему данные и приборы.
Онлайн-данные, полученные от различных приборов, могут быть объединены в группу по общим признакам. По группам можно строить графики, отчеты, таблицы, а также устанавливать пороги срабатывания тревог.
Сервис Cold Chain Cloud позволяет пользователю мониторить и управлять приборами удаленно в режиме реального времени, отображать архивы данных, создавать графики, таблицы, отчеты за определенные периоды времени, экспортировать данные в PDF-файл. В графиках можно изменять масштаб по осям X и Y, добавлять и удалять дополнительные оси, настраивать оси, цвет, тип линий и т.д. На детализированный график можно выводить как один выбранный параметр, так и группу параметров. Над основной областью построения детализированного графика реализован виджет «временная линейка» с предварительным просмотром трендов графиков. Этот виджет позволяет пользователю быстро и интуитивно выделять нужный временной отрезок для построения детализированных графиков.
В Cold Chain Cloud реализована гибкая система настройки аварийной сигнализации. Можно задавать пороги срабатывания тревог, а также настраивать пользователей, которым осуществляется рассылка сообщений о тревоге через Telegram или любой другой интернет-мессенджер, либо по электронной почте. В зависимости от наличия связи с приборами, нахождения данных в нормальном, предаварийном или аварийном состоянии, цвет значений данных и цвет групп изменяются в онлайн-режиме. Кроме того, оператор, подключённый в онлайн-режиме, видит мигающий значок аварии в верхней части экрана, который перестает мигать только после подтверждения (квитирования) данной тревоги оператором.
Cold Chain Cloud обеспечивает ведение технологического журнала, журнала действий пользователей и системного журнала. В технологическом журнале фиксируются все тревоги и сбои в технологическом оборудовании. Там же фиксируется реакция пользователей на тревоги: кто из пользователей и когда их подтверждал (квитировал). В журнале действий пользователя записываются изменения настроек и конфигураций сервиса Cold Chain Cloud, проектов, групп и данных, выполненные конкретными пользователями в конкретное время.
Cold Chain Cloud имеет возможность создавать мнемосхемы технологических процессов в виде виджетов с активными элементами. Виджеты позволяют визуализировать процесс мониторинга и управления в реальном времени. Виджеты — это опция, создаваемая под заказ под конкретный технологический процесс и согласовываемая с Заказчиком согласно его техническому заданию.
Смотрите также: